Fat-Soluble Vitamin Deficiency in Pediatric Patients with Biliary Atresia

Insights
Fat-soluble vitamin deficiency is common in pediatric biliary atresia (BA) patients, especially vitamin D. Supplementation is crucial for those with unresolved jaundice post-Kasai procedure.
Area of Science:
- Pediatric Gastroenterology
- Hepatology
- Nutritional Science
Background:
- Biliary atresia (BA) is a severe cholestatic liver disease in infants.
- Fat-soluble vitamin (FSV) deficiencies are common complications in pediatric liver diseases.
- The Kasai procedure is a surgical intervention for BA to restore bile flow.
Purpose of the Study:
- To investigate fat-soluble vitamin (FSV) levels in pediatric patients with biliary atresia (BA).
- To analyze FSV levels before and after the Kasai procedure.
- To assess the impact of jaundice resolution on vitamin levels post-surgery.
Main Methods:
- Prospective study of pediatric patients with obstructive jaundice.
- Measurement of FSV levels and liver function tests.
- Serial assessments at baseline, 2 weeks, and 1, 3, 6 months post-Kasai procedure.
Main Results:
- FSV deficiency, particularly vitamin D, was more pronounced in BA patients compared to other cholestatic conditions.
- Younger BA patients exhibited more severe preoperative 25-hydroxy vitamin D (25-(OH)D) deficiency.
- Higher 25-(OH)D levels were observed in patients with jaundice resolution at 3 months post-surgery.
Conclusions:
- Preoperative FSV deficiency is prevalent in pediatric BA, with vitamin D deficiency being most common.
- Postoperative FSV deficiency persists, especially in patients with unresolved jaundice.
- Long-term vitamin A and D supplementation is recommended for BA patients with persistent jaundice after the Kasai procedure.
Objective:
To analyze the levels of fat-soluble vitamins (FSVs) in pediatric patients with biliary atresia (BA) before and after the Kasai procedure.
Methods:
Pediatric patients with obstructive jaundice were enrolled in this study. The FSV levels and liver function before, 2 weeks after, and 1, 3, and 6 months after the Kasai procedure were measured.
Results:
FSV deficiency was more obvious in patients with BA than in patients with other cholestatic liver diseases, especially vitamin D deficiency. 25-Hydroxy vitamin D (25-(OH)D) deficiency was more pronounced in younger patients before surgery. The 25-(OH)D level was significantly higher in patients with than without resolution of jaundice 3 months after surgery. At 6 months after surgery, the 25-(OH)D level was abnormally high at 8.76 ng/ml in patients with unresolved jaundice.
Conclusions:
Preoperative FSV deficiency, particularly vitamin D deficiency, is common in patients with BA. 25-(OH)D deficiency is more pronounced in younger children before surgery. Postoperative FSV deficiency was still prevalent as shown by the lower 25-(OH)D levels in patients with BA and unresolved jaundice. This required long-term vitamin AD supplementation for pediatric patients with BA and unresolved jaundice after surgery.
